Javanese Man Uses Horse As A Mobile Library

PURBALINGGA, CENTRAL JAVA, INDONESIA - MAY 05: 42 year old Ridwan Sururi writes the name of who borrow the book on May 5, 2015 in Serang Village, Purbalingga, Central Java Indonesia. Ridwan, a horses caretaker from Serang Village in Central Java, initiated the mobile library using a horse named "Kudapustaka" on January 2015 with book donations from his friend Nirwan Arsuka and other donors. Every week on Tuesday, Wednesday and Thursday he visitÕs nearby schools to offer books for the children. Ê (Photo by Putu Sayoga/Getty Images)
